■Items to check before locking
the vehicle
To prevent unexpected triggering of
the alarm and vehicle theft, make
sure of the following.
Nobody is in the vehicle.
The windows are closed before
the alarm is set.
No valuables or other personal
items are left in the vehicle.
■Setting
Close the doors and hood, and lock
all the doors using the entry func-
tion or wireless remote control. The
system will be set automatically
after 30 seconds.
The security indicator changes from
being on to flashing when the system is
set.
■Canceling or stopping
Do one of the following to deacti-
vate or stop the alarm.
Unlock the doors using the entry
function or wireless remote con-
trol.
Start the EV system. (The alarm
will be deactivated or stopped
after a few seconds.)
■System maintenance
The vehicle has a maintenance-free type alarm system.

■The intrusion sensor and tilt
sensor detection
The intrusion sensor detects
intruders or movement in the
vehicle.
The tilt sensor detects changes
in vehicle inclination, such as
when the vehicle is towed away.
This system is designed to deter
and prevent vehicle theft but does
not guarantee absolute security
against all intrusions.
■Setting the intrusion sensor
and tilt sensor
The intrusion sensor and tilt sensor
will be set automatically when the
alarm is set. ( P. 7 7 )
■Canceling the intrusion sensor
and tilt sensor
If you are leaving pets or other
moving things inside the vehicle,
make sure to disable the intrusion
sensor and tilt sensor before setting
the alarm, as they will respond to
movement inside the vehicle.

■Canceling and automatic re-
enabling of the intrusion sensor and tilt sensor
●The alarm will still be set even when the intrusion sensor and tilt sensor are canceled.
●After the intrusion sensor and tilt sen-sor are canceled, pressing the power
switch or unlocking the doors using the entry function (if equipped) or wireless remote control will re-enable
the intrusion sensor and tilt sensor.
●The intrusion sensor and tilt sensor
will automatically be re-enabled when the alarm system is reactivated.
●The intrusion sensor will automatically be canceled when the remote air con-ditioning system is activated.
■Intrusion sensor detection consid-erations
The sensor may trigger the alarm in the
following situations:
●People or pets are in the vehicle.
●A window is open.
In this case, the sensor may detect the
following:
• Wind or the movement of objects such as leaves and insects inside the vehi-cle
• Ultrasonic waves emitted from devices such as the intrusion sensors of other vehicles
• The movement of people outside the vehicle
●Unstable items, such as dangling accessories or clothes hanging on the coat hooks, are in the vehicle.
●The vehicle is parked in a place where extreme vibrations or noises occur,
such as in a parking garage.
Page 82 of 674

80
Owners Manual_Europe_M42D76_en
1-4. Theft deterrent system
●Ice or snow is removed from the vehi-
cle, causing the vehicle to receive repeated impacts or vibrations.
●The vehicle is inside an automatic or high-pressure car wash.
●The vehicle experiences impacts, such as hail, lightning strikes, and other kinds of repeated impacts or
vibrations.
■Tilt sensor detection consider- ations
The sensor may trigger the alarm in the
following situations:
●The vehicle is transported by a ferry,
trailer, train, etc.
●The vehicle is parked in a parking
garage.
●The vehicle is inside a car wash that
moves the vehicle.
●Any of the tires loses air pressure.
●The vehicle is jacked up.
●An earthquake occurs or the road caves in.
●Cargo is loaded onto or unloaded from the roof luggage carrier.

■When riding in an aircraft
When bringing an electronic key onto an
aircraft, make sure you do not press any buttons on the electronic key while inside the aircraft cabin. If you are carry-
ing an electronic key in your bag, etc., ensure that the buttons are not likely to be pressed accidentally. Pressing a but-
ton may cause the electronic key to emit radio waves that could interfere with the operation of the aircraft.
■Electronic key battery depletion
●The standard battery life is 1 to 2 years.
●If the battery becomes low, an alarm will sound in the cabin when the EV
system stops.
●To reduce key battery depletion when the electronic key is to not be used for
long periods of time, set the electronic key to the battery-saving mode. ( P.204)
●As the electronic key always receives radio waves, the battery will become
depleted even if the electronic key is not used. The following symptoms indicate that the electronic key battery
may be depleted. Replace the battery when necessary. ( P.499) • The smart entry & start system or the
wireless remote control does not oper- ate.• The detection area becomes smaller.
• The LED indicator on the key surface does not turn on.
You can replace the battery by yourself
( P.499). However, as there is a danger that the electronic key may be dam-aged, it is recommended that replace-
ment be carried out by any authorized Toyota retailer or Toyota authorized repairer, or any reliable repairer.
●To avoid serious deterioration, do not leave the electronic key within 1 m (3
ft.) of the following electrical appli- ances that produce a magnetic field:•TVs
• Personal computers • Cellular phones, cordless phones and battery chargers
• Recharging cellular phones or cord- less phones• Table lamps
• Induction cookers

■Impact detection door lock release
system
In the event that the vehicle is subject to a strong impact, all the doors are
unlocked. Depending on the force of the impact or the type of accident, however, the system may not operate.
■Operation signals
The emergency flashers flash to indicate that the doors have been locked/unlocked. (Locked: once;
Unlocked: twice)
A buzzer sounds to indicate that the win- dows are operating.
■Security feature
If a door is not opened within approxi- mately 30 seconds after the vehicle is unlocked, the security feature automati-
cally locks the vehicle again.
■When the door cannot be locked by the lock sensor on the surface of the door handle
When the door cannot be locked even if the lock sensor on the surface of the door handle is touched by a finger, touch
the lock sensor with the palm. When gloves are being worn, remove the gloves.
■Open door warning buzzer
If an attempt to lock the doors is made
when a door is not fully closed, a buzzer sounds continuously for 5 seconds. Fully close the door to stop the buzzer,
and lock the vehicle once more.

■Effective range (areas within which
the electronic key is detected)
When locking or unlocking the doors
The system can be operated when the
electronic key is within about 0.7 m (2.3
ft.) of the front door handles, rear door
handles (if equipped) and back door
opener switch. (Only the doors detecting
the key can be operated.)
When starting the EV system or
changing power switch modes
The system can be operated when the
electronic key is inside the vehicle.
